Adding animations files from newer client with UOFiddler
I am using an older, pre-artLegacyMUL.uop client and am hoping to extract some of the newer mobile artwork from more recent clients as .vd and upload them onto mine.

I downloaded a copy of the Classic Client from Broadsword and patched it all the way. I then made a copy of my client and replaced anim.idx, anim.mul, anim2, anim2.idx, anim3.idx, anim3.mul, anim4.mul, anim4.idx, anim5.idx, anim5.mul, animdata.mul, body.def, bodyconv.def, and mobtypes.txt.

I loaded UOFiddler (4.6) and set the paths to that of my copy, but the new mobiles do not appear. I tried loading a new copy of UOFiddler and still no luck.

Is this possible? And if, so what am I doing wrong? Thanks in advance!
